Loosen Connections: Use pliers or wrench to gently loosen the plastic elbow pipe fittings

When tackling the task of removing a plastic elbow pipe, the first step is to focus on loosening the connections securely and without causing damage. Plastic fittings can be delicate, so it’s crucial to use the right tools and techniques. Begin by identifying the type of fitting connected to the elbow pipe. Common types include threaded connections, push-fit joints, or compression fittings. Once identified, select the appropriate tool—either pliers or a wrench—that matches the size and shape of the fitting. For threaded connections, a wrench is often more effective, while pliers may be better suited for gripping smaller or smoother surfaces.

Before applying force, ensure the tool is positioned correctly to avoid slipping, which could damage the fitting or pipe. Place the pliers or wrench around the fitting, ensuring a firm grip. If using a wrench, align it with the flats of the fitting to maximize control and minimize stress on the plastic. For pliers, use the adjustable jaws to grip the fitting securely, but avoid clamping too tightly, as plastic can crack under excessive pressure. Always apply gentle, steady force to loosen the connection rather than abrupt movements, which can cause breakage.

If the fitting is stubborn and resists loosening, consider using a penetrating oil or lubricant to help free it. Apply the lubricant around the connection and allow it to sit for a few minutes before attempting to loosen it again. This can be particularly helpful for fittings that have been in place for a long time or are exposed to moisture, which can cause corrosion or mineral buildup. After applying the lubricant, retry loosening the fitting with the pliers or wrench, maintaining a gentle approach to avoid damage.

In some cases, plastic fittings may be secured with additional components, such as locking nuts or collars. If present, these should be addressed before attempting to loosen the main fitting. Use the pliers or wrench to carefully remove or loosen these components first, ensuring they do not obstruct the removal process. Once any secondary components are dealt with, focus on the primary fitting, applying consistent, gentle force until it begins to turn. If resistance is encountered, reassess the grip and ensure the tool is properly aligned before proceeding.

Finally, as the fitting loosens, be prepared to support the pipe or surrounding structure to prevent unnecessary stress or movement. Plastic pipes can be brittle, and sudden shifts can lead to cracks or breaks. Once the fitting is sufficiently loosened, it can be unscrewed or detached by hand. If it still feels tight, use the tool to complete the removal, but continue to apply gentle force to avoid damaging the threads or the pipe itself. Cut if Stuck: If the pipe is stuck, carefully cut it using a utility knife or saw

When dealing with a stuck plastic elbow pipe, cutting it carefully is often the most effective solution. Begin by assessing the situation to ensure that cutting the pipe is the best course of action. If the elbow pipe is deeply embedded or fused due to age, heat, or adhesive, cutting may be the only viable option. Gather the necessary tools: a utility knife, a fine-toothed saw (such as a hacksaw), safety gloves, and safety goggles to protect yourself from debris. Ensure the area around the pipe is clear to avoid damaging surrounding materials.

Before making any cuts, mark the exact location where you intend to sever the pipe. Use a marker or tape to indicate the cutting line, ensuring it’s straight and precise. If the elbow pipe is part of a larger system, turn off the water supply or disconnect any attached components to prevent leaks or accidents. Position the utility knife or saw at the marked line and apply steady, controlled pressure. For a utility knife, score the pipe deeply several times until it begins to weaken. If using a saw, guide the blade along the marked line, maintaining a consistent angle to achieve a clean cut.

When cutting plastic, be mindful of the material’s tendency to crack or splinter. Work slowly and avoid applying excessive force, as this can cause the pipe to break unevenly. If using a saw, choose a blade designed for cutting plastic to minimize the risk of damage. For curved elbow pipes, adjust your cutting angle as needed to follow the shape of the pipe. Take breaks if necessary to reassess your progress and ensure the cut remains accurate.

Once the cut is complete, carefully remove the severed section of the pipe. Use pliers or a pipe wrench to grip and twist the remaining piece if it’s still stuck. Be cautious not to damage any threads or connections on adjacent pipes. After removal, inspect the area for any remaining debris or sharp edges. Smooth out rough edges with sandpaper or a file to prevent injuries or interference with new fittings.

Finally, prepare the area for replacement or repair. Clean the pipe ends and surrounding area to ensure a secure fit for new components. If reusing the existing system, measure and cut the replacement pipe accurately to match the original dimensions. Always follow manufacturer guidelines for installing new fittings or seals to maintain the integrity of the plumbing system. Replace Elbow: Install a new elbow pipe, ensuring tight connections and proper alignment for functionality

When replacing a plastic elbow pipe, the first step is to ensure you have the correct replacement part. Measure the diameter of the existing pipe and verify the type of fitting (e.g., PVC, CPVC) to match the new elbow pipe. Once you have the appropriate replacement, prepare the area by turning off the water supply to the affected line to avoid leaks during the installation process. Gather the necessary tools, such as a pipe cutter, deburring tool, primer, cement, and a cloth for cleaning. Proper preparation ensures a smooth and efficient installation.

Before installing the new elbow pipe, inspect the existing pipe ends for any damage, burrs, or debris. Use a pipe cutter to trim the pipe ends if necessary, ensuring a clean, straight cut. After cutting, use a deburring tool to remove any sharp edges or remnants from the pipe’s interior and exterior. This step is crucial for achieving a tight seal and preventing leaks. Clean the pipe ends and the inside of the new elbow fitting with a dry cloth to remove dust or particles that could interfere with the connection.

Next, apply a suitable primer to both the pipe ends and the inside of the new elbow fitting. The primer prepares the surfaces for adhesion by softening the plastic slightly. Allow the primer to dry for a few seconds, then apply PVC or CPVC cement to the same areas. Quickly insert the pipe ends into the elbow fitting, ensuring proper alignment and a secure fit. Hold the connection firmly for about 30 seconds to allow the cement to set initially. Wipe away any excess cement with a cloth to maintain a clean installation.

After securing the new elbow pipe, check the alignment to ensure it matches the original configuration or the desired angle for proper functionality. Misalignment can cause stress on the pipes and fittings, leading to future issues. Once satisfied with the alignment, allow the cement to cure fully according to the manufacturer’s instructions before restoring the water supply. This curing time is essential for achieving a strong, leak-free connection.

Finally, test the new elbow pipe by turning the water supply back on and inspecting the joints for any signs of leakage. If leaks are detected, tighten the connections slightly or reapply cement as needed. Regularly inspect the area over the next few days to ensure the repair holds.
